Output 187069e4bf7a32aec56e2276773e10d53cf0fbbbd7682e7ffd01ba4e014002c6:29

value
57959
script pubkey
OP_0 OP_PUSHBYTES_20 3804c86a40584b7d4a1b36c9cc2e57aa4b48c15f
address
bc1q8qzvs6jqtp9h6jsmxmyuctjh4f953s2lm5js7f
transaction
187069e4bf7a32aec56e2276773e10d53cf0fbbbd7682e7ffd01ba4e014002c6